Shaun White, the most decorated Olympic snowboarder in history, shredded it up in the Central Park snow this weekend.
White, who is nicknamed the “The Flying Tomato” for his red hair, was spotted jumping over comedian Shane Gillis during the storm on Sunday on Cedar Hill, which is within the park near East Drive and the 79th Street Transverse.

White is a five-time Olympian and a three-time gold medalist in the half-pipe snowboarding event. He also holds the record for most X Games medals, in which he’s won 23 across snowboarding and skateboarding.
“I took a photo of a random person with a snowboard outside my apartment today,” one resident who lives near Central Park wrote on X. “Turns out it was LITERALLY SHAUN WHITE.”
White was reportedly snowboarding in the park from 3:30 to 5 p.m. on Sunday.

White is retired from competing in the Olympics, but he will be a commentator for NBC at the upcoming Winter Games in Italy this February.
